Abstract: Some aspects are directed to additive manufacturing systems. An example additive manufacturing system controller is configured to receive a build file comprising instructions for controlling the manufacturing hardware to generate the object, receive a material identifier indicating a particular lot of manufacturing media, validate the build file and the material identifier via a distributed ledger to verify at least one of an author of the build file or an origin of the particular lot of manufacturing media, control the manufacturing hardware using the build file to generate the object using the particular lot of manufacturing media, and in response to completion of the generation of the object, generate an object manufactured transaction to the distributed ledger indicating a result of the validation of the origin of the at least one of the build file or the material identifier.
